Chaz, we do use extending leads but when we are on the beach/downs etc. On the roads we used to use them locked as short as possible to allow the dogs to walk to heel but now we use stronger rope short leads. Tell you what I do think are a very bad idea of a lead...you know those elasticated short stretchy ones. I do no think they are safe for control of the dogs.
